ConfidentialClientApplication.AcquireTokenForClient Methode

Definition

Erwirbt ein Token von der in der App konfigurierten Autorität für den vertraulichen Client selbst (im Namen eines Benutzers) mithilfe des Clientanmeldeinformationsflusses. Siehe https://aka.ms/msal-net-client-credentials.

public Microsoft.Identity.Client.AcquireTokenForClientParameterBuilder AcquireTokenForClient(System.Collections.Generic.IEnumerable<string> scopes);
abstract member AcquireTokenForClient : seq<string> -> Microsoft.Identity.Client.AcquireTokenForClientParameterBuilder
override this.AcquireTokenForClient : seq<string> -> Microsoft.Identity.Client.AcquireTokenForClientParameterBuilder
Public Function AcquireTokenForClient (scopes As IEnumerable(Of String)) As AcquireTokenForClientParameterBuilder

Parameter

scopes
IEnumerable<String>

Bereiche, die für den Zugriff auf eine geschützte API angefordert wurden. Für diesen Fluss (Clientanmeldeinformationen) sind die Bereiche von Microsoft APIs, die durch AAD-Token geschützt sind, das Formular "{ResourceIdUri/.default}". For examplehttps://management.azure.net/.default, or, for Microsoft Graph, https://graph.microsoft.com/.default. Die angeforderten Bereiche werden mit der Anwendungsregistrierung im Portal statisch definiert und können nicht in der Anwendung überschrieben werden.

Gibt zurück

Ein Generator, mit dem Sie optionale Parameter hinzufügen können, bevor Sie die Tokenanforderung ausführen

Implementiert

Hinweise

Sie können auch die folgenden optionalen Parameter verketten: WithForceRefresh(Boolean)Microsoft.Identity.Client.AbstractAcquireTokenParameterBuilder`1.WithExtraQueryParameters(System.Collections.Generic.Dictionary{System.String,System.String})

Gilt für: